Opinion of the Court

PER CURIAM.

Upon the authority of Ellis v. Outler, 25 Okla. 469, 106 P. 957, this cause is reversed and remanded, with directions to the trial court to vacate the order and judgment heretofore entered in accordance with the prayer of the petition in error for the reason that, the defendant in error has failed to comply with the requirements of this court under rule 7.
